With a blower cam you don't want or need a cam that has a lot of overlap that would bleed off the boost from the blower. Also you would want a cam with more exhaust duration to keep the exhaust valve open a bit longer to get the spent exhaust gases out. It also depends on your engine displacement. If you have a 383 or a 396 stroker you will want more intake duration to match the longer stroke event of the crankshaft.

LPE makes a blower grind that is a 215/220 @.050 lift with .530/.530 lift ground on a 114 LSA. This cam makes great power, nearly 600HP on a supercharged small block with a SR manifold on very modest boost levels. It does idle nearly like a stock cam as well.

I am running a 224/236 custom ground Comp Cam which was ground on a 112 LSA. But I have a 396 displacement LT1 as well.

I too run a 224-236 cam. I run a 114 LSA...that gives me 1 degree of overlap @ .050"...see below for formula:

((224 +236)/4)-114 LSA = 1 degree of overlap at .050" lift

An increase in duration without a corresponding increase in LSA will result in less boost...stock cams usually do well as blower grinds.

I run a 248I/254E duration custom Comp Cams solid roller with 112 Lobe Separation.

Based on the formula you have mentioned, I derive the following:
((248+254)/4)-112 LSA = 13.5° overlap

This is the first that I have seen of this formula, and it difers a bit (by 1/2) from what I derived from the cam card supplied from Comp. The cam card defines the valve timing events (@ 0.050") as follows:


Intake open - 12 BTDC Intake close - 56 ABDC
Exhaust open - 59 BBDC Exhaust close - 15 ATDC

Based on a 720° cycle for a 4 stroke engine, the following would apply.
Exh close - 15°, Intake close - 236°, Exh open - 481°, Intake open - 708°

To my understanding, the determination of everlap is while the exhaust valve is open following the power stroke (from 481° thru 15°), the intake valve just begins to open (from 708° thru 236°), causing some (more in the case of Forced Induction) of the fresh charge to exit the combustion chamber without being consumed.

In the above example, the overlap would be from 708° (IO) thru 15° (EC).
overlap = 15° - 708° (same as -12°)
overlap = 15° - (-12°)
overlap = 27°

Why does the difference of 1/2 exist? Your formula is certainly much simplified over plotting the valve timing events, but nonetheless, is different from what I had understood to be correct.In your cam, it would be the difference of 1° or 2° of overlap, which really is splitting hairs.

As a side note, I used your formula to calculate my old HR blower cam that made 545RWHP in a 350ci motor. ((228° + 228°)/4)-114 = 0° overlap.

You're right, the formula is off by 2x @ the overlap calculation. I'm an idiot when it comes to this stuff...this is how I understand it:

1. 248 crank degrees/2 (2:1 cam/crank ratio) = 124 cam degrees int.
2. 254 crank degrees/2 (2:1 cam/crank ratio) = 127 cam degrees exh.
3. 124 + 127 = 251 total cam degrees open
4. 251/2 lobes = 125.5 average open cam degrees per lobe
5. 125.5 - 112 (known lobe separation) = 13.5 overlap in "cam degrees"
6. 13.5 * 2 (2:1 crank/cam ratio) = 27 crank degrees of overlap

In the previous formula, I forgot to include the formula for converting ioverlap to crank degrees. The corrected formula should read:

(((int+ext)/4)-lsa)*2=overlap

Please note: A negative overlap number would represent the overlap occuring at some point less than the expressed lift value used in the calculation (e.g., @ 0.050"). I hope this this helped.

The formula works if it is understand that LSA is expressed in cam degrees and duration is expressed in crank degress.

(((224+236)/4)-114)*2= 2 degrees of overlap

Just testing!!

My cam card says:

-2 BTDC Int. open (or 2 degrees ATDC)
4 ATDC Exh. close

-2 - 4=2 degrees overlap

Competition Cams LT1 Xtreme Energy Nitrous & Supercharger Cams Xtreme Energy Cams are Comp Cams newest series of hydraulic cams. They are designed to take advantage of the latest improvements in valvetrain components and the newest developments in camshaft design. Their ggresive lobe design produces better throttle response and top end horsepower than other cams with the same duration @ .050" while delivering increased engine vacuum. Comp Cams Xtreme Energy Cams can be used in any street or street/strip application where both throttle response and top end horsepower are desired. Maximize torque, acceleration, and throttle response providing excellent high RPM horsepower Faster intake valve opening increases engine vacuum and enhances throttle response Special intake closing ramps close valve earlier providing more cylinder pressure and torque without valve train noise Faster ramps achieve maximum velocity sooner, increasing the area under the lift curve and providing maximum horsepower

Part # Description Price:

CCA-212-224-14 mild applications good mid and upper RPM power
Dur@.050 212-224 | Lift .487-.503 | LSA 114 | RPM Range 1200-5600 245.95

CCA-218-230-14 High Performance street w-100-150 HP nitrous or blower
Dur@.050 218-230 | Lift .495-.510 | LSA 114 | RPM Range 1600-5900 245.95

CCA-224-236-14 Street-Strip 125+HP Nitrous needs converter, gears, choppy idle
Dur@.050 224-236 | Lift .503-.521 | LSA 114 | RPM Range 2000-6200 245.95
